RCIA– Rite of Christian Initiation
Becoming Catholic is a process that is unique to each person that comes in our doors. When you feel the time is right have a conversation with one of the staff about how to enter into the process formally. Until then we also have some meetings called inquiry sessions just to talk about the faith. Talk to any of our staff for more information.
